Revolutionizing Precision: How Picosecond Glass Laser Cutting is Transforming Modern Manufacturing

0
15

In today’s high-tech world, precision and speed are more important than ever. Industries are constantly seeking technologies that offer accuracy without compromising efficiency. One of the most revolutionary innovations in recent years is picosecond glass laser cutting. Unlike traditional cutting methods, this technology uses ultra-short laser pulses measured in picoseconds—one trillionth of a second—to create flawless cuts in glass with minimal thermal impact.

The most striking advantage of picosecond laser cutting is its extraordinary precision. Glass is notoriously fragile and prone to cracking under heat. Conventional laser cutters can generate significant heat, causing chipping, micro-cracks, or surface deformation. Picosecond lasers, however, deliver energy so rapidly that the glass vaporizes in a controlled manner before heat can transfer to surrounding areas. This results in smooth, clean edges without the risk of damage, making it ideal for delicate applications such as smartphone screens, medical devices, and optical components.

Another major benefit is versatility. Picosecond lasers can cut complex shapes, intricate patterns, and extremely thin or thick glass with the same level of accuracy. Designers and engineers are no longer limited by material thickness or structural fragility. This opens new opportunities in industries like architecture, electronics, and even luxury goods, where customized glass designs are increasingly in demand.

Efficiency is another key selling point. Although the process uses high-tech equipment, the speed of picosecond pulses allows for faster production cycles compared to mechanical cutting methods. Reduced waste, fewer errors, and minimal need for post-processing contribute to lower production costs and higher-quality results.
